Sorry for my ignorance here, I've been handloading for over 20 years, and about 5 years ago a very good friend and shooting buddy decided he had little interest in handloading, but was fascinated by casting. We're a match made in heaven! Anyway, I'm messing with loads for a .45 LC, and back before he got into casting, my favorite cast bullet for the LC was a Bullet Meister 250 GN. RNFP. Right now, we have a ton of Keith style SWCs that he casted that we love, but they won't reliably feed in my Uberti 1860 Henry. The Bullet Meisters work great in this rifle, however. They have a rounded shoulder and perfect OAL. He told me instead of ordering more BM's, get a mold and he'll make me some. Well, I'm doing some research, and am looking for a mold that the seating groove gives me a good OAL (2.600") for this gun on a RNFP 250ish grain slug. I don't necessarily need to match the Bullet Meister one exactly, but pretty darned close would make me a happy feller.

The 250 lrnfp described is fairy common of the massed produced older style, meant for commercial casting machines. A lot of differing company's used em.  If memory holds, the bevel base is for ease of bullet release from the mold.  Looks like they offer them for hand casters now.
